What FastLocal Verifies Before Listing a Provider
FastLocal does not automatically list businesses.
Before a provider can receive calls through our platform, we verify the following:
1. Business Identity Verification
We confirm:
- Legal business name
- Operating city or service area
- Public business presence such as:
- Website
- Google Business Profile
- Trade directory listing
- Public customer reviews
Providers must demonstrate that they actively operate in the city they are listed under.
2. Local Service Confirmation
FastLocal focuses on local emergency connections.
We verify that the provider:
- Physically services the listed city or nearby area
- Is not a national call center pretending to be local
- Can dispatch technicians within the stated service region
We do not allow anonymous lead resale chains.
3. Live Call Acceptance Testing
Before going live, providers must:
- Successfully answer test calls
- Confirm they handle the listed emergency service
- Demonstrate they can accept real time inbound calls
Providers who repeatedly fail to answer calls are removed.
4. Service Category Validation
Providers are listed only under services they confirm they perform.
For example:
- Plumbing calls go to plumbing providers
- HVAC calls go to HVAC providers
- Locksmith calls go to locksmith providers
We do not route calls across unrelated categories.
Ongoing Provider Standards
Once listed, providers must agree to:
- Answer emergency calls professionally
- Clearly communicate pricing structure before work begins
- Provide realistic arrival time estimates
- Comply with local licensing requirements where applicable
- Avoid deceptive or aggressive sales tactics
FastLocal monitors:
- Answer rates
- Call responsiveness
- Complaint patterns
Providers who fail to meet standards may be suspended or removed.
How Complaints Are Handled
If you believe a provider you reached through FastLocal acted improperly:
- Contact the provider directly first.
- If the issue is not resolved, contact FastLocal with:
- Date and time of the call
- Service type
- City
- Description of the issue
FastLocal will:
- Review call logs
- Review call recordings when available
- Contact the provider for response
- Track complaint frequency
If we identify repeated misconduct, the provider will be removed from the platform.
FastLocal does not mediate billing disputes or guarantee outcomes. However, documented patterns of misconduct directly affect a provider’s eligibility.
Call Recording & Transparency
Calls connected through FastLocal may be recorded for:
- Quality assurance
- Provider verification
- Complaint investigation
When recording is active, both parties are notified prior to connection.
Recordings are used internally and are not publicly distributed.
